I don't know the Windflite design, but on the Sunfish, IMHO, the storage
compartment makes it more difficult to add hiking straps. With the older
model Fish it was easy to install an inspection port in front of and behind
the cockpit. With that addition you could reach in and place backing blocks
at the lower edges of the cockpit to anchor the straps into. I wonder if
this approach might work on your boat?

I have a Windflite 14 and yes it is almost a Sunfish. Some of the
drawbacks are Sunfish racing clubs won't let you join/race.
There is no aft storage compartment and it would be difficult to
add hiking straps. Other than these things the boat is a blast.
I am not sure about $1,000.00 unless there are no bumps/scrapes
and the trailer is in perfect condittion. There are always great
buys on e-bay. I keep seeing Sunfish for less than $1,000.00.
There are also newer boats available as well
